In California, you must file proof of service of summons within 60 days after serving the papers. This time frame is crucial to ensure that the court recognizes the service and can move forward with the case. Timely filing is especially important when your case involves a CA Document 98 Order Granting Defendant, as delays could affect your legal standing.

To file proof of service with the court in California, complete the proof of service form and include details about how and when the papers were served. Submit the completed form along with your other case documents at the court clerk's office. Remember to keep a copy for your records, as it's important for any follow-up regarding your CA Document 98 Order Granting Defendant.

File proof of service is a legal document that verifies that court papers were delivered to the party involved in a case. It serves as confirmation that the other side has received the necessary information, allowing the legal process to continue. The most effective way to serve someone court papers in California is by using a professional process server. They understand the legal requirements and can ensure proper delivery. Alternatively, you can have a reliable friend or family member serve the papers, as long as they are not involved in the case.
